In a regenerative brake for a DC traction motor (1, 2), the armature (1), a reactor (3), a network thyristor controller (4) and a parallel circuit consisting of a capacitor (5) and a deactivable thryistor controller (6) can be connected in series to the network (N). The series circuit formed from armature (1) and reactor (3) can be by-passed by means of an armature thyristor controller (7) in such a way that when the armature thyristor controller is conductive the armature circuit is short-circuited and the reactor (3) is magnetically charged and, when the armature thyristor controller is disabled, is connected via the network thyristor controller (4) and the capacitor (5) and the energy stored in the reactor (3) is transmitted to the network (N). A control device for the motor voltage is provided by changing the exciter current, which device is fed a signal which is proportional to the armature current (Ja), a signal which is proportional to the speed (n) of the traction motor, a signal which is proportional to the voltage (U1) upstream of the capacitor (5), a signal which is proportional to the voltage (Un) downstream of the capacitor (5) and a signal which is proportional to the speed (n) of the traction motor. In the upper motor speed range in which the motor voltage produced is greater than or the same as the network voltage, the armature current thyristor controller (7) and the network thyristor controller (4) are alternately opened and closed in opposite directions. In this process, the entire kinetic energy of the vehicle can be fed back into the network largely without loss. <IMAGE>
